ROBERT MACGEORGE'S Store, Tay -street. Country [Storekeepers, Miners and Carricre can be supplied with the undermentioned Goods at the lowest CASH prices : — Flour— finest Adelaide and Tasmanian, in 50 and 200 lb bags Oats, chaff, and bran Oatmeul Rice and biscuits Ale and porter, in hhd, cask and case Brandy — Otard's Champagne, United Central, and other brands, in hhds, 4-caßks and cases Geneva, JDKZ, in case Old Tom, do Whisky, in and case Rum, in hhds Bitters, cordials, &c. Wines — port and sherry, in i-casks and case Butter — Cork and colonial Cheese— finest North Wilts and Dunlop Currants and raisins— finest new fruit in barrels and ense Bottled fruits, jams and pickles Salid oil, sauces and other oilmens' stores Salmon in tins, Findon haddocks, sardines and lobsters Sugars — finest white crystals and counter Tea in chests and halves Tobacco — tens and twist, cutty pipes, meersham do Yeast powders IRONMONGERY AND BUILDING MATEBIALS. All kinds of timber Galvanised iron Calico Canvas Picks, cradles, gold dishes, do scales Shovels Camp ovens Nails, screws Bellows Anvils Steel yards Mats and matting Chaff-cutters and corn crushers Drays, just landed ex Wm Buchanan CLOTHING— DRAPEUY— BOOTS AND SHOES, An excellent assortment of every descrition, in Stock and landing.
